Angel With An M16

There is a tale I can relate to you And I can guarantee that it’s true It’s about a battle just north of Hue On a hot and sultry summer’s day. VCs were in control and we had laid back But today was the day we chose to attack. Some said we didn’t stand a ghost of a chance Nevertheless we chose to advance. The fighting became heavy and loses were fierce. Charlie had defenses we just couldn’t pierce. I looked and could see troops falling beside me From flashes of enemy fire I could see. Things became blurry and eerie around me And I sensed firing coming from behind me. I saw VC troops falling like flies – I could hardly believe what I saw with my eyes. The firing behind me kept finding its mark As the battle continued almost till dark. A sense of victory soon became ours As Charlie continued to lose firepower. As I waited for enemy fire to find me I could sense the fire grow heavy behind me. The enemy continued to fall before us Things began looking good for us. We continued advancing and soon left no doubt The victory was ours, and it was a rout. I was in some kind of a daze Everything was covered by some sort of haze. The firing that saved us was a real mystery It was heavy and deadly and brought victory. I turned back to see and all that was seen Was an angel standing there with an M16. Written by John Posey 5/12/15
